Delivering Smarter Security Operations Across Queensland
National Elite Security (NES) specialises in the provision of high-quality security personnel across a range of operational environments and client requirements.
Their services include:
- Crowd Controllers for licensed venues and major events
- Static Guards for people, property, and asset protection
- Expanding Cash-in-Transit (CIT) services through the acquisition of a Brisbane-based financial logistics and First Line Maintenance (FLM) provider
As the business continued to grow, the team needed a workforce management platform capable of supporting increasingly complex rostering, payroll preparation, compliance oversight, and client reporting requirements.
The Challenge
Before implementing Cerely, National Elite Security was operating on a platform that struggled to keep pace with the operational demands of a modern security business.
The previous system created inefficiencies across several critical areas of the business, including:
- Rostering workflows
- Payroll preparation
- Invoice processing
- Accounting software integration
- Operational visibility
- Client reporting
The lack of integration with accounting systems caused ongoing friction between scheduling, timesheets, and invoicing processes, increasing administrative workload and introducing avoidable operational bottlenecks.
At the same time, the team wanted a more professional and modern platform experience that could also provide stronger reporting and analytics capabilities for clients.
“The platform we were using previously was very dated and didn’t give us the ability to connect to our accounting programs properly. This was causing multiple problems from rostering to invoicing.”

Strengthening Compliance and Reducing Operational Risk
Compliance management has also become significantly more proactive.
Cerely’s automated compliance notifications help the team stay ahead of:
- Security licence expirations
- Certificate renewals
- Staff compliance requirements
The system provides advance notice of upcoming expirations, giving management more time to communicate with staff and avoid compliance gaps.
Operationally, the reporting and analytics functionality has also helped the business identify problematic areas across sites and make more informed staffing decisions.
“Cerely has made our life at NES a lot easier by giving us morning and evening updates on compliance issues. If we have staff whose licence or certificate expirations come up, Cerely gives us prior notice and gives us plenty of time to inform staff.”
